As an actor, Charles Chaplin appeared in 86 films, beginning with "Making a Living" (1914) and ending with "A Countess from Hong Kong" (1967). He directed 72 films beginning with "Twenty Minutes of Love" (1914) and ending with "A Countess from Hong Kong" (1967).

Nita Naldi of silent films was born Anita Donna Dooley on 1 April 1897 and had a twenty year career ending in 1940.
George Chandler appeared in 374 films beginning with "Speed and Spurs" (1928) and ending with "The Apple Dumpling Gang Rides Again" (1979).

Kenneth Williams - Starred in 26 films Joan Sims - Starred in 24 films Charles Hawtrey - 23 films Sid James - 19 films Kenneth Connor - 17 films Peter Butterworth - 16 films Bernard Bresslaw - 14 films Hattie Jacques - 14 films Jim Dale - 11 films Peter Gilmore - 11 films Barbara Windsor - 10 films Patsy Rowlands - 9 films Jack Douglas - 8 films Julian Holloway - 8 films Terry Scott - 7 films Valerie Leon - 6 films John Pertwee - 4 films
Van Johnson appeared in 81 films beginning with an uncredited role in "Too Many Girls" (1940) and ending with "Three Days to a Kill" (1992).
